Claims (10)
1. Isoleret polypeptid med cellobiohydrolaseaktivitet, som er valgt fra et polypeptid, der udviser mindst 81% sekvensidentitet med aminosyrerne 19 til 464 ifølge SEQ ID NO: 2.
2. Isoleret polypeptid med cellobiohydrolaseaktivitet, som omfatter et katalytisk domæne valgt fra et katalytisk domæne, der udviser mindst 90% sekvensidentitet med aminosyrerne 105 til 464 ifølge SEQ ID NO: 2.
3. Enzymsammensætning, som omfatter polypeptidet ifølge et hvilket som helst af kravene 1-2.
4. Isoleret polynukleotid, som koder for polypeptidet ifølge et hvilket som helst af kravene 1 -2.
5. Nukleinsyrekonstruktion, som omfatter polynukleotidet ifølge krav 4 operativt forbundet til en eller flere fremmede kontrolsekvenser, der styrer fremstillingen af polypeptidet i en ekspressionsvært.
6. Rekombinant værtscelle, som omfatter nukleinsyrekonstruktionen ifølge krav 5.
7. Fremgangsmåde til fremstilling af et polypeptid med cellobiohydrolaseaktivitet, hvilken fremgangsmåde omfatter: (a) dyrkning af værtscellen ifølge krav 6 under betingelser, som er befordrende for fremstilling af polypeptidet; og (b) indvinding af polypeptidet.
8. Fremgangsmåde til nedbrydning af et celluloseholdigt materiale, hvilken fremgangsmåde omfatter: behandling af det celluloseholdige materiale med en enzymsammensætning i nærværelse af polypeptidet med cellobiohydrolaseaktivitet ifølge et hvilket som helst af kravene 1-2.
9. Fremgangsmåde ifølge krav 8, som endvidere omfatter indvinding af det nedbrudte celluloseholdige materiale.
10. Fremgangsmåde til fremstilling af et fermenteringsprodukt, hvilken fremgangsmåde omfatter: (a) forsukring af et celluloseholdigt materiale med en enzymsammensætning i nærværelse af polypeptidet med cellobiohydrolaseaktivitet ifølge et hvilket som helst af kravene 1-2; (b) fermentering af det forsukrede celluloseholdige materiale med en eller flere fermenterende mikroorganismer for at fremstille fermenteringsproduktet; og (c) indvinding af fermenteringsproduktet fra fermenteringen.
